i need help with my sound system help plz
I just got a 07 mustang and when I bought it apparently the previous owner took out the factory stereo and put in a cd player. But when I turn the volume up or put in a cd in I can c thats it working but I'm not getting any sound out the speakers? Does anyone know y?
Well theres about 100 reasons that could be happening lol. First i would say go through all the settings on the cd player and make sure nothing is turned off. Then next thing would be check all the wiring and make sure its hooked up correctly. Is it a shaker system?
I have a shaker 500 with an aftermarket head unit I installed myself. I just wanted to add here that there are also fuses for the shaker amps in the fuse box in the engine compartment. If you have a Shaker 1000 system there will be 30 amp fuses in positions 6 and 9. If you have a Shaker 500 system there will be a single 30 amp fuse in position 16.
That being said, if the stereo is wired correctly and is actually working you should still hear sound from the upper door speakers and the speakers from the rear. I pulled the fuses myself to test and all I lost was the bass.
I would pull the stereo and check for appropriate wiring. Hopefully the previous owner purchased the appropriate harness and did not attempt to simply splice into the factory wires. Sometimes people try to cut corners and you end up with a terrible mess. If you dont feel comfortable doing that then you might want to have a car stereo shop have a look at it.
Do you have contact information for the previous owner? Would you be able to contact them and find out when or why it stopped working?
